Market Development for Ellington Credit Company, formerly Ellington Residential Mortgage REIT, centers on taking its established expertise in corporate Collateralized Loan Obligations (CLOs) into new investor segments and geographies. This strategy leverages the current focus on a market described as a $1.5 trillion opportunity, with gross issuance year-to-date reaching over $1 trillion as of Q3 2025.

The first vector involves targeting non-US institutional investors, such as European pension funds, who manage approximately $4.9 trillion in assets. These funds are showing increasing interest in private assets, with the euro-domiciled private credit market reaching €106 billion in Q2 2024. Ellington Credit Company can position its CLO mezzanine debt and equity tranches, which generated a weighted average GAAP yield of 15.5% on the portfolio as of September 30, 2025, as an attractive, yield-enhancing alternative to traditional fixed income, especially given the current U.S. CLO BBB Tranche Spreads ranging from 260 to 300 basis points.

Expansion of distribution channels must include wealth management platforms and Registered Investment Advisors (RIAs) catering to high-net-worth clients. The RIA channel in the U.S. is substantial, with the firms covered in Schwab's 2025 study representing over $2.4 trillion in assets under management (AUM). The top 20 fee-only RIAs in 2025 command nearly $424 billion in combined AUM. Penetrating this segment means reaching advisors who are actively seeking differentiated, income-producing assets to meet client demand for tailored strategies.

A dedicated marketing campaign aimed at retail investors should heavily emphasize the yield potential inherent in the closed-end fund structure. For the quarter ended September 30, 2025, Ellington Credit Company maintained a monthly distribution of $0.08 per common share, which translated to an 18.6% distribution rate based on the November 18 closing stock price of $5.17. This high yield, supported by Net Investment Income (NII) of $0.23 per share in Q3 2025, is a key selling point for retail capital seeking current income. The Net Asset Value (NAV) per share stood at $5.99 as of the quarter-end.

To access new capital pools, the company should actively explore listing the fund on a secondary exchange in a major financial hub outside the U.S. This move would follow the strategic transformation into a regulated investment company (RIC) structure, which the company believes will enhance its access to capital markets. The current total assets stand at $415.7 million as of September 30, 2025, indicating a need for broader capital access to fuel further CLO portfolio growth, which increased by 20% to $379.6 million in Q3 2025 alone.

Capturing a different segment of the existing U.S. market requires product innovation tailored to specific investor needs. The company should introduce a new share class specifically designed for tax-advantaged accounts, such as IRAs or 401(k)s. This structural adjustment would help insulate yield-focused investors from the corporate income tax burden that applies to the company operating as a taxable C-Corp throughout 2024 before its conversion to a RIC.

The market for middle-market CLOs shows strong technical support. In Q3 2025, AAA spreads on these instruments narrowed to 155 bps, compared to 131 bps for broadly syndicated loan (BSL) CLOs. This suggests that a dedicated middle-market CLO product could capture a yield premium while attracting capital seeking the perceived lower default risk of private credit structures, which often feature more conservative leverage, such as 2:1 versus 10:1 in BSLs.

Product Focus Market Metric (Q3 2025) Comparative Data Point
Middle-Market CLO AAA Spread 155 bps BSL AAA Spread: 131 bps
CLO Mezzanine Yield 6.82% AAA CLO Yield to Worst: 4.75%
EARN CLO Portfolio Yield (GAAP) 15.5% EARN Net Investment Income (Q3 2025): $8.5 million

For the non-Agency RMBS vehicle, the market is showing significant growth. Non-QM RMBS pricing volume in Q3 2025 reached $20.9 billion, which is substantially higher than the $10.6 billion seen in Q3 2024. This increased supply, coupled with the fact that some securitized segments are offering better relative value for managers willing to dig into structures, supports launching a dedicated vehicle. A peer fund held 23% in non-agency RMBS as of September 30, 2025, with a portfolio yield-to-worst of 11.20%.

The floating rate structure appeals directly to the current interest rate environment. CLOs, being floating rate, benefit from rate cuts, like the one the Fed implemented in September 2025. For investors concerned about duration risk, a shorter-duration or floating-rate focused CLO product directly addresses the structural advantage that made AAA-rated CLOs a magnet for capital, especially when an ETF tracking them offered a trailing yield of 6.39% in early 2025.

You're looking at how Ellington Residential Mortgage REIT (EARN), now operating as Ellington Credit Company, can expand its business into new markets or products, which is the Diversification quadrant of the Ansoff Matrix. Since the company completed its transition to a CLO-focused closed-end fund on April 1, 2025, its current credit exposure is heavily weighted toward that asset class. As of September 30, 2025, the CLO portfolio stood at $379.6 million, up from $316.9 million the prior quarter, representing a nearly 100-fold increase since September 2023 from just $3.8 million. The weighted average GAAP yield on this portfolio for the quarter was 15.5%, and the company received $16.2 million in recurring cash distributions. This existing credit focus provides a foundation for further, more distinct diversification moves.

Entering the esoteric ABS space, which includes aircraft receivables, has shown a rebound in 2025 following muted activity in 2022 and 2023. For instance, the aircraft ABS market saw issuances totaling around $7-9 billion for the full year 2025. The structure of these deals is evolving, with some recent transactions featuring younger aircraft collateral.

Shifting focus to private credit means targeting a sector that has become a primary source of capital for middle-market companies. Private credit grew to $1.5 trillion in 2024, and direct lenders funded over 70% of mid-market transactions during recent market turbulence. This move would be a significant step beyond securitized assets, as evidenced by partnerships like Citi and Apollo's $25 billion private credit direct lending program.

Establishing a non-US platform via European leveraged loans would tap into a market that reached €420 billion in size by early 2025. While Q2 2025 saw leveraged loan origination drop to €66.7 billion, institutional spreads widened to 391 basis points, suggesting potential repricing opportunities for new entrants.
